Folk/Review Mahto and The Loose Balloons - Something Old, Something New, Something Borrowed, Something Blue

Mahto and The Loose Balloons, hailing from Johnson City, United States, is a musical project led mostly by Mahto himself, with a touch of collaboration from his friend Niko Graham, who contributed the song "Crisscross" to the EP, adapted in the Mahto style. Matt Sykes from Downspout Records handled the mixing and mastering of the tracks, resulting in a cohesive and authentic sound.

Pop/Review Aaron Amos - I Feel Numb

Born and raised in Germany, the American-German singer Aaron Amos released his first original music in late 2018, while still trying to figure out which musical direction he wanted to approach. During 2021, the 25-year-old collected some new ideas, which eventually became his second EP with songs like "Nightrides" or "Wildcat." Listening to various groups and genres such as Little Dragon, Roosevelt, GATC, Twin Shadow, and St. Lucia, Aaron is not afraid to experiment with different sounds.

Pop/Review Ava Valianti - Buttercups

Ava Valianti is a 15-year-old singer-songwriter from Newbury, Massachusetts, whose raw, indie-pop sound blends emotional honesty with unforgettable melodies. Since her 2023 debut, she’s released a string of standout singles—including Middle Ground, Distant, and her latest, Buttercups—earning airplay on 200+ radio stations, two New England Music Award nominations, and runner-up honors at the International Acoustic Music Awards.

Hip-Hop/Review Nuk - Top Tier

Nuk, hailing from Lansdowne, United States, is a remarkable independent artist who has honed his skills over the years. Originally from Brooklyn, NY, Nuk now resides in Delaware County, PA, where he continues to craft his music. With a passion for songwriting that started at the tender age of nine and recording music by 14, Nuk has dedicated years to perfecting his unique sound.

Folk/Review Moira Chicilo - Poets & the Misfits

Moira Chicilo is a Canadian singer-songwriter living in Vancouver, BC. Moira writes songs that speak to the everlasting pull of place and the relentless journey of life, mixing elements of indie folk like Wilco with ethereal sounds such as Mazzy Star and Portishead. For Moira, the music always starts with the story, reflecting on themes such as loss, the fragility of nature, human connection, and choices.

Rock/Review Wonderlick - Rhinoceros

Wonderlick's two founding members, Jay Blumenfield and Tim Quirk, came together in December 2000 to record free music for a website. The two had previously performed together under different guises (most notably as one half of the smart punk-pop outfit), but this new project resulted in a concept album that was crafted over the course of a year.
